Brush or comb your hair any way you like. It really makes no difference which way it faces or how you style it. The best thing to do is make sure it's clean and washed regularly (at least for hygenic reasons). Other than that, how you choose to style it is really up to you.



The oils from the scalp do help keep the hair moisturized, but you can get the same effect by using a proper conditioner. So, yes, there is some truth to the fact that not washing your hair does keep it conditioned better. But, too much oil and it's difficult to style and it also can begin to smell. So, while not washing it may keep it a little better conditioned, it's best to wash it to keep it from smelling bad. I would suggest that, instead of not washing it, you use a conditioner and then get some frizzease to add a little bit of oil back into the hair.



Splashing water on the hair also moisturizes it. But, that evaporates. That's why you would want to add some leave-in conditioner or frizzease into the hair to lock in the moisture.



Be careful, though. Too much product can definitely make the hair look bad as well. So, you'll need to experiment.
